Job Description:
Duties • Install all makes and models of HVAC Equipment, Install ventilation, install all types of duct work for both commercial and residential customers. Take Ownership of projects and assist with time management. •Meet installation quality and time guidelines & goals. •All jobs completed same day unless priced otherwise •Meet time requirements for being at job site – on time. •Remain up-to-date and current on all installation procedures. •Meet code of conduct and company appearance codes and all other codes set forth in the company employee handbook, including substance abuse policy, and ethics policy. •Assists in locating and diagnosing problems in duct systems assessing extent of repairs and describing options and associated costs to the customer if needed. Provides a description of diagnosed problems to customer in terms that can be understood with options, as possible. •?Assists with installation of complete systems to include calibrating or replacing controls, switches, thermostats, gauges for start ups, control wiring, condensers, piping and other functional components of the system. • Travel to job sites in service area, and work with dispatch to ensure schedule is maintained and delays are properly communicated to customer. • Be available to work nights or weekends, on a rotating basis, to service emergency needs of our customers. • Maintain good working order of company vehicle including refueling as necessary, reporting any mechanical issues, and filling out and submitting monthly vehicle inspection form. Vehicles should be washed on a regular basis. • Maintain proper stock, parts, tools, and safety equipment in the vehicle. • Understand company pricing and generate appropriate customer invoice at job site. Electronically process credit card payments. Obtain customer signature at completion of job. Obtain correct customer information including email address. • Document all installed and/or service equipment upon arrival: make, model, serial number, type of fuel, necessary test measurements, and pictures as necessary. • Participate in company provided training opportunities on latest industry technologies. • Identify and report to owner potential opportunities for additional business (newer system, service contracts, and additional services).
